Output 63c35f5b83b82f33e653ae506aca98d7d22eae2a9aba33f623422573d71ba87c:6

value
10938832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3296ff1f5b00f6d751a9c87cf687038ebfc78f43 OP_EQUAL
address
MCWeuSuYsFkCqMaxnoDGG4TJdPGHeRnF9J
transaction
63c35f5b83b82f33e653ae506aca98d7d22eae2a9aba33f623422573d71ba87c
spent
true